Wellington Christian Church
Lexinton, KY When Wellington Christian Church contacted us for this project, their sound engineer had already mapped out a plan for this multipurpose room. Through several meetings we discovered more efficient ways of designing and installing the sound, light and video systems.
The main speaker cluster consists of three Mackie Industrial PA151 speaker cabinets, augmented by two EAW SB181p subwoofers for low end kick. We used the Mackie DX810 signal processor to route all the signals and control the dynamics for the mains and the stage monitors.
The lighting system consists of 26 ETC Par EA light fixtures to provide stage lighting, and one ETC Source IV ellipsoidal fixture to provide light for the baptismal area. The lights are controlled from the sound booth by a Lightronics digital light board, which also controls house lighting, giving the operator complete control over the lighting system during worship services. In efforts to protect the lighting system, the church decided to create a wall on the ceiling to protect the light fixtures from being damaged during sporting events.
